About Haqikos

The research company behind QIA and PayQIA.

Haqikos exists because every AI agent — no matter how capable in a single session — forgets everything when that session ends. Developers rebuild memory logic from scratch, again and again, with no shared standard and no persistent layer beneath the LLM.

Work on this problem started in 2024. The first thing we built was QIA — a context and intelligence engine designed to handle semantic search, context compression, and automatic memory decay properly, rather than offloading those decisions to the calling developer every time. QIA became the foundation. PayQIA is the first product shipped on top of it.

The three-layer structure — Haqikos (company) → QIA (engine) → PayQIA (product) — exists for a specific reason: keeping the research layer separate from the shipped product means QIA can evolve as a proper engine family, with future products built on it, rather than being permanently coupled to one product's constraints. The same reason Anthropic keeps Claude the model separate from Claude.ai the product.

How we work

We label unverified claims as unverified.

Every benchmark number on haqikos.ai and payqia.com is marked as internal, pre-launch, or independently verified — nothing in between. We carry this from PayQIA's own disclosure standard.

Research and product inform each other directly.

QIA's retrieval architecture is shaped by what we're learning in research on context compression and graph decay — not by what sounds good in a press release. The Systems Lab and product team are the same people.

Memory infrastructure must be deletable, not just fast.

Speed without control is a liability in production. Every memory stored in QIA can be explicitly deleted by the developer at any time. The right to forget is an API primitive, not a support request.
